A vintage saucer featuring a delicate pink and green flowers and leaves motif. Made in Staffordshire, England by British manufacturers Johnson Brothers as part of their 'Snowhite' range. Introduced in 1960 and produced through the mid-20th century. Made of white ironstone, a durable type of earthenware/ceramic, and featuring a glossy glazed finish.
